city of burbank statement regarding gun stores:

 

There has been confusion on certain categories of essential businesses, including gun shops.  The County has clarified gun shops are essential businesses under the Safer at Home Order, which aligns with the Governor’s stay at home executive order, and may remain open.  Unfortunately, the Sheriff added to the confusion yesterday when he announced gun shops should be closed, but last night he reversed himself. The City is under the jurisdiction of Los Angeles County Public Health for purposes of the pandemic, and as such the City follows their orders.
